I came to UK in July 2006. Initially I had a WP running from JUL 2006 – JUL 2008. Then I extended it with the help of my employer for further 5 years. It was valid from JUL 2008 – JUL 2013. In the meantime, once my ILR qualified period (5 Yrs) was over, I applied for ILR & hold the ILR stamp since NOV 2011.

Now my question to all my intelligent friends in the forum is; do I need to wait until NOV 2012 to apply for the Citizenship or based on my original WP since I have now completed the 6 Yrs residency in the UK, can I go ahead & apply for my Citizenship?

1 year after ILR unless married to BC.

There is no 6 years requirement. There are two requirements: 5 year residence, 1 year after ILR which for many people means 6 years.
